Lesson Objectives (Objectifs de la leçon)

Lesson Objectives

By the end of this lesson, students will be able to:

✔ Introduce themselves (name, origin, age, etc.).

✔ Ask and answer questions about personal information.

✔ Talk about jobs, languages, marital status, and hobbies.

✔ Hold simple dialogues.

✔ Write a short self-introduction.

1.Vocabulary & Key Phrases

  • Personal Information

Name: first name, last name / surname

Age: I am ___ years old.

Address: street, city, country

Phone number: “My phone number is…

Email: My email address is…

  • Origin & Residence

Country: I am from [country].

City: I live in [city].

Verb: to live (NOT “to inhabit” – common mistake!)

  • Jobs

Student / teacher / salesperson / driver / nurse

Phrase: I am a [job]. / I work as a [job].

  • Languages

Verb: to speak (I speak English and French.)

Key languages: English, French, Spanish, German, etc’

  • Hobbies

to read, dance, cook, play soccer/football, listen to music

Phrase: My hobbies are…” / “I like to…

  •  Marital Status

Single / married / divorced / widowed

Phrase: I am [status].

2. Expressions for Self-Introduction

Greetings & Responses

Informal: Nice to meet you!

Formal: It’s a pleasure to meet you.

Questions and answers for Introductions

Topic

Question

Answer

Name

What’s your name?

My name is Anna. / I’m Paul

Origin

Where are you from?

 I’m from Cameroon.

Residence

Where do you live?

I live in Douala.

Age

How old are you?

I’m 22 (years old).

Job

What do you do? / What’s your job?

I’m a student. / I work as a nurse.

Languages

What languages do you speak?

I speak French and English.

 

| Marital Status

Are you married?

No, I’m single.

No, but I am engaged (Non, mais je suis fiancé)

Hobbies

What are your hobbies?

I like dancing and cooking

  1. Question Structure (Wh- Questions)

Wh-word + auxiliary + subject + verb?

– Where do you live?

– What languages do you speak?

  1. Dialogues

Dialogue 1: First Meeting (Informal)

A: Hi! What’s your name?

B: My name is Daniel. And you?

A: I’m Laura. Where are you from?

B: I’m from Cameroon. Nice to meet you!

Dialogue 2: In a Classroom (Formal)

Teacher: What’s your name?

Student: I’m Marc. I live in Bafoussam.

Teacher: What languages do you speak?

Student: I speak French and a little English.
